Honor Flight of the Quad Cities traveled with 80 veterans to Washington D.C.

This was the 59th annual flight for the organization. The veterans spent the day in the nation’s capitol, visiting memorials built in their honor. This flight carried a World War II veteran, three Korean War veterans and many who were stationed in Vietnam. The group is scheduled to return
to Quad Cities International Airport around 10:00 p.m. The community is invited to welcome the group back home at the airport. Parking is free.
